Texting with RingCentral

This article will walk you through how to use the Texting feature in RingCentral. This would be most useful when contacting external parties. For internal communications, unless you have a specific reason to text, it makes the most sense to use the messaging feature. The following are step by step instructions on how to use this feature are:

1. Log into RingCentral with the desktop app or in your Chrome browser at https://app.ringcentral.com

2. Click the Text icon on the left hand side

3. All of your current conversations will appear under the Text list on the left hand side. To select a text, simple click it from the list. You should see it appear in the center portion of your application.

4. To write back to a message, write it in the text box. When you are ready to send the message, click Enter on your keyboard. You can also attach files to the conversation or put an emoji by clicking on the paper clip or smiley face. 

5. To send a new text, click the Quote bubble with the plus sign at the top of the Text list. You can also click the plus sign in the upper right corner of the screen and select Send New Text. Either way will take you to the same place. 

 

 

6. The Text From number is your RingCentral number. Leave this as is.

If you are sending a text internally, type the name of the person you would like to text in the To field and select them from the list. If you are sending a text externally, type in the phone number of the person that you are texting to. PLEASE NOTE: The number that you will be texting from is your RingCentral phone number. Your personal phone number will NOT be used to text anyone, even if you are using the mobile app.

7. You can send text messages to external and internal contacts at the same time. When you include more than one contact on a text, the group text button is automatically checked off. This means that this conversation is public to everyone listed inside the To field. If you do not want to make this a group text, simply uncheck it. The message will then be sent separately to all of the contacts listed in the box. 

 

8. When you are ready to send your text, click Next

 

9. A conversation will now open up in RingCentral where you can put your message. Press the paper airplane to the right of the message to officially send your text.
